Main Panel Replacement in Utah County, UT

Main panel replacement services involve upgrading or replacing the main electrical panel that distributes power throughout a property. This project is often requested when the existing panel is outdated, damaged, or no longer meets the electrical demands of the home. Property owners typically seek this service to improve safety, ensure code compliance, or accommodate the installation of new appliances and electrical systems. It can also be necessary after a panel has experienced issues such as frequent tripping, corrosion, or physical damage, which may compromise the electrical system’s reliability and safety.

Before requesting main panel replacement, property owners usually want to understand the scope of the project, including the size and capacity of the new panel, as well as any necessary upgrades to the electrical wiring or systems. It’s important to consider the age of the current panel, the electrical load requirements of the household, and any local electrical code regulations that may influence the replacement process. Having clear information about these factors can help ensure the new panel is appropriately sized and installed to meet the property’s current and future electrical needs.

Main Panel Replacement Questions

When is a main panel replacement needed? A main panel replacement is recommended when the existing panel shows signs of rust, frequent tripping, or outdated design that no longer meets safety standards.

What are common signs indicating the need for a new main panel? Signs include frequent circuit breaker trips, burning smells, buzzing noises, or visible damage such as corrosion or rust.

How does a main panel replacement improve safety? Replacing an outdated or damaged panel reduces the risk of electrical fires and ensures the system can handle current electrical demands safely.

What types of property projects typically require main panel upgrades? Property upgrades for increased electrical capacity, renovations, or addressing code compliance often involve replacing the main panel.
